St. Helena is home to Schweiger Vineyards, a huge vineyard and winery best known for its Merlot, Port and Cabernet. The winery offers tours to small groups and requests 48 hours' advance notice for parties of more than six people.

Pride Mountain Vineyards is one of the popular wineries located in St Helena. They offer a variety of quality wines with stunning views of the surrounding valley and an exciting tour of the nearby caves. The service is prompt and friendly and the prices are reasonable.

Smith-Madrone Vineyards are a small operation with a small selection of wines. They do, however, offer detailed tours, including a look into the grape crushing process.

The Bothe-Napa State Park is a state park that has opportunities for swimming, hiking, picnicking, year-round camping, and wildlife viewing. The park also has a network of 10-miles of hiking trails.

Named after the famous author of Treasure Island and Kidnapped, Robert Louis Stevenson State Park is the location where he and his wife spent their honeymoon. There is nothing left of Stevenson's original cabin, but the park does feature a five-mile hiking trail which offers panoramic views of San Francisco.

Larkmead Vineyards is a popular local winery which offer quality wines, with 2010 Firebelle and 2010 Cabernet Sauvignon being their more popular varieties. The hosts are friendly and know their wines. You can also enjoy beautiful views of the surroundings from the patio.

The beautiful Spanish mission-style façade of the Jacuzzi Family Vineyards invites visitors to come inside for a memorable wine tasting experience. Five-wine tastings are free and do not require a reservation. Groups must schedule more extensive tastings in advance.

Apart from the free wine tasting services, reasonably priced wines and attentive staff, Cline Cellars also maintains a beautiful surrounding landscape which includes many ponds, orchards, a museum of scale models of California missions, gift shop and more.

Tours of Schramsberg Vineyards in Calistoga, California are given by appointment only and include exploration of the caves in which the wines are aged. All tour participants must be at least 21 years old and wear footwear with excellent traction.
